Abstract
These proceedings consist of 43 presented papers on control of damage caused by many different animals. After an "overview" session, papers were presented in sessions titled: Carnivores, Urban, Big Game, Birds, and Rodents and Lagomorphs.Titles contained within Ninth Great Plains wildlife damage control workshop proceedings
